How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Laytonsville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Laytonsville Studio Apartments | $1,616 | $1,220 | $1,925 |
| Laytonsville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,833 | $1,153 | $2,641 |
| Laytonsville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,130 | $1,355 | $3,287 |
Laytonsville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,461 | $1,520 | $2,962 |
| Laytonsville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,168 | $2,362 | $3,700 |

Largest Available Laytonsville and Nearby 3 Bedroom Apartments
The largest available 3 Bedroom apartment unit in Laytonsville, MD is found at Saybrooke Apartments in the Stewart Town neighborhood and is 1,400 square feet priced from $2,552. Streamside Apartments has the second largest 3 Bedroom, which is sized at 1,261 square feet and currently listed start at $2,500. Here is today’s list of the largest available 3 Bedroom units in Laytonsville: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Square Footage | Priced From |
|---|---|---|---|
| Saybrooke Apartments | C1 - Classic Interior | 1,400 Sq Ft | $2,552 |
| Streamside Apartments | 3 Bedroom | 1,261 Sq Ft | $2,500 |
| Tamarron Apartment Homes | Three Bedroom 2 Bath w/ Den - 1,260 sqft | 1,260 Sq Ft | $2,896 |
| Summit Crest | 3Bedroom Den 2Bathroom | 1,129 Sq Ft | $2,686 |
Cheapest Available Laytonsville and Nearby 3 Bedroom Apartments
As of March 02, 2026 the lowest priced 3 Bedroom apartment unit in Laytonsville, MD is the 3 Bedroom Model starting from $2,500 at Streamside Apartments in the Stewart Town neighborhood. The second most affordable Laytonsville 3 Bedroom is the C1 - Classic Interior Model at Saybrooke Apartments starting at $2,552 . The average price for all 3 Bedroom apartments in Laytonsville is currently $2,461.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available 3 Bedroom options in Laytonsville: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Priced From |
|---|---|---|
| Streamside Apartments | 3 Bedroom | $2,500 |
| Saybrooke Apartments | C1 - Classic Interior | $2,552 |
| Summit Crest | 3Bedroom Den 2Bathroom | $2,686 |
| Tamarron Apartment Homes | Three Bedroom 2 Bath - 1,150 sqft | $2,821 |
